     Your Committee on Labor & Public Employment, to which was referred S.B. No. 2323, S.D. 1, entitled:

 

"A BILL FOR AN ACT MAKING APPROPRIATIONS FOR PUBLIC EMPLOYMENT COST ITEMS,"

 

begs leave to report as follows:

 

     The purpose of this measure is to fund all collective bargaining cost items in the agreement negotiated with the exclusive bargaining representative of collective bargaining unit (9) and for state officers and employees excluded from collective bargaining unit (9) due to an impasse in negotiations for fiscal year 2012–2013.

 

     The Department of Budget and Finance and Hawaii Government Employees Association, AFSCME, Local 152, AFL-CIO testified in support of this measure.

 

     Your Committee finds that registered professional nurses under bargaining unit (9) rejected an initial collective bargaining agreement between their exclusive representative and the public employers thus leading to the exclusive representative and the public employer to declare an impasse.  Bargaining unit (9) is subject to binding arbitration as a means of impasse resolution.  As such, an arbitration panel will decide the terms that will be awarded.  If an arbitration panel decides in favor of the nurses, funds will need to be made available for their new contract.  This measure serves as a vehicle for funds to be appropriated.

 

     As affirmed by the record of votes of the members of your Committee on Labor & Public Employment that is attached to this report, your Committee is in accord with the intent and purpose of S.B. No. 2323, S.D. 1, and recommends that it pass Second Reading and be referred to the Committee on Finance.
